The specialized freight trucking industry in the United States is a significant economic force, worth over $125 billion annually. This robust sector is experiencing steady growth, driven primarily by nationwide infrastructure projects and the increasing demand for renewable energy transport.
Scale is a defining characteristic of this industry, with more than 10 million oversize/overweight permits issued annually across the country. These permits primarily facilitate the transport of construction equipment, generators, turbines, and agricultural machinery.
Most heavy hauls involve substantial loads weighing between 40,000 to 120,000 pounds and spanning up to 20 feet wide, highlighting the specialized expertise required for safe and efficient transport.
California stands out among the top three states for oversize transport demand, a position attributed to its bustling ports, extensive agricultural operations, and thriving technology manufacturing centers.
Coastal states like California face additional complexity due to environmental protection zones along transport routes, with approximately 15% of heavy hauls involving marine-related industries.
Customer expectations in this specialized industry are clear and demanding. A recent industry survey revealed that 92% of heavy equipment buyers consider on-time delivery and damage-free transport their top priorities.

Texas is traversed by major freight routes such as I-10, I-20, I-35, I-45, and I-37, facilitating seamless access for oversize and overweight loads across this vast state.
Texas hosts vital logistics hubs including the Port of Houston (one of the nation's busiest ports), Port of Corpus Christi, Port of Beaumont, and major industrial centers in the Gulf Coast, Dallas-Fort Worth Metroplex, and Eagle Ford Shale region, supporting energy, manufacturing, agricultural, and technology transport needs.

Navigating heavy haul regulations in Texas requires careful attention to the Texas Department of Transportation (TxDOT) guidelines. TxDOT's Motor Carrier Division oversees permitting and enforcement, ensuring the safety and integrity of the state's infrastructure.
Oversize/overweight permits in Texas are crucial for legally transporting loads exceeding standard limits. These permits specify routes, restrictions, and necessary safety measures. Applications are typically submitted online through the TxPROS system, TxDOT's permitting portal.
Texas takes a pragmatic approach to oversize/overweight loads, recognizing their importance in various industries, from energy to construction. However, strict adherence to regulations is essential to avoid penalties and ensure public safety. Texas is known for having some of the longest continuous routes available to permitted loads, making pre-planning absolutely essential.
Standard weight limits in Texas are 80,000 pounds gross vehicle weight, 20,000 pounds on a single axle, and 34,000 pounds on a tandem axle. These limits apply to interstate highways and most state routes. Exceeding these limits requires an overweight permit.
Texas does not typically enforce seasonal weight restrictions like some northern states. However, local jurisdictions may impose temporary restrictions on certain roads or bridges during inclement weather. Always check local advisories before transporting heavy loads, especially during the rainy season or after significant weather events.
The maximum legal dimensions in Texas without a permit are 8 feet 6 inches (102 inches) in width, 14 feet in height, and 65 feet in length for a combination vehicle (tractor and trailer).
Loads exceeding these dimensions require an oversize permit. Specific requirements vary based on the extent of the oversize. Loads exceeding 16 feet in width or 18 feet in height often require route surveys and additional safety precautions.
In Texas, escort vehicle requirements depend on the dimensions of the load. Generally, a front escort is required for loads exceeding 12 feet in width. Both front and rear escorts are required for loads exceeding 14 feet in width or 16 feet in height. Length restrictions also dictate escort requirements, especially on two-lane roads.
Police escorts are typically required for extremely oversized loads, particularly those exceeding 16 feet in width or 18 feet in height, or when traveling through major metropolitan areas like Houston, Dallas, or San Antonio. TxDOT will specify police escort requirements on the permit based on the route and dimensions.
To obtain an oversize/overweight permit in Texas, you must apply through the TxPROS system. This online portal allows you to submit applications, upload required documents, and track the status of your permit. It's essential to have accurate dimensions, weights, and route information ready before applying.
Required documentation typically includes vehicle registration, insurance information, a detailed description of the load, and a proposed route. For extremely heavy loads, bridge analysis may be required.
Permit processing times in Texas can vary depending on the complexity of the load and route. Simple permits may be processed within 24-48 hours, while more complex permits requiring route surveys or bridge analyses can take several days to a week or more. Permit fees are based on the weight and distance traveled. A basic permit might cost around $25, but fees can increase significantly for heavier or longer loads. Contact TxDOT's Motor Carrier Division at (800) 299-1700 for specific fee inquiries.
Certain highways and bridges in Texas have weight or size restrictions. TxDOT publishes lists of restricted routes, and it's crucial to consult these lists when planning your route. The TxPROS system also flags restricted routes during the permit application process.
Texas generally allows oversize/overweight loads to travel during daylight hours, Monday through Friday. Weekend travel may be restricted in some areas or for extremely oversized loads. Travel is often prohibited during major holidays. Nighttime travel may be permitted with specific authorization and proper lighting.
Major cities like Houston, Dallas, San Antonio, and Austin often have additional restrictions on oversize/overweight loads, particularly during peak traffic hours. Check with local authorities for specific requirements in these metropolitan areas.
